How do you read the scriptures?
 Let me ask you a question. How many times do you simply read through the Bible hoping to pick up something that will help you get through the day or answer a problem you might have? I know that I am guilty of this time and time again. I force myself to sit and read through the scriptures from time to time hoping to understand something and come closer to God or to become a little steadier in my walk with Christ. There is something I want you to consider that I just came across and it hit me like a brick. it comes from person by the name of Gipsy Smith. Gipsy Smith told of a man who said he had received no inspiration from the Bible although he had "gone through it several times." "Let it go through you once," replied Smith, "then you will tell a different story!" If we just simply make time to sit with the Lord with an open heart not as a child forced to go to school, but as a child with eyes and a heart willing to listen and learn oh what the Lord will show you and the scriptures will come alive for you.

Next time you sit to read your Bible sit for a moment or two and do nothing but sit in silence and listen and pray for a moment. You are about to talk to God and listen to His Word. have a reverence for what you are doing. The book you hold is a Holy Book it is the Word of God Himself. written to you 200 years ago have some respect for it and for Him before you enter into His word. Pray for the leading of the Holy Spirit that God will open the scriptures to you and show you what He wishes you to know. He will teach you but you must be willing to listen and to what you read. Take your preconceived notions of the Bible and leave them outside the cover. As you enter the Word of God, humble yourself that He may teach you.
